Understanding the memorandum and order

A memorandum and order serve as crucial legal documents that outline a court's decisions, rulings, or directives regarding a particular case. These documents are significant in communicating formal decisions made by judges, particularly in cases that involve legal interpretation and statutory application. By detailing the court's reasoning behind its rulings, a memorandum and order provide a clear record that aids in transparency and accountability within the judicial system.

The memorandum typically contains a summary of the legal arguments presented by both parties, relevant laws, and a conclusion drawn by the court. Meanwhile, the order usually prescribes the actions to be taken by the parties involved, based directly on the court's findings. Therefore, it holds immense importance as a guiding document for compliance with court rulings.

Defines the court’s ruling on particular issues.
Clarifies the expectations for compliance by the parties.
Acts as a reference for future cases involving similar legal issues.

Preparing your memorandum and order

When preparing a memorandum and order, it is vital to include essential components that enhance its effectiveness. Key elements include the title of the document, relevant court details, and the case number, which allows for easy identification. Each component serves a distinct purpose; for instance, the title reflects the nature of the memorandum while the court details confirm its legitimacy.

Furthermore, the importance of clarity and specificity cannot be overstated. A well-structured document eliminates ambiguity and ensures that its recipients fully understand the court's position. History has shown that vague language can lead to misunderstandings and compliance issues. Thus, prioritizing detailed, clear language in every section is crucial to achieving the desired outcomes.

Title: Clearly state the nature of the order.
Court details: Include the court’s name, address, and relevant identifiers.
Case number: A unique identifier essential for tracking the case.

Step-by-step guide to drafting a memorandum and order

Drafting a memorandum and order involves several steps, commencing with thorough research. Identifying relevant legal precedents and statutes is paramount, as it informs the legal arguments and supports the court’s rationale. Online databases offer extensive resources for retrieving applicable case law, regulations, and advisory opinions that underpin your arguments.

After researching, structuring your document correctly is essential. A standard memorandum and order format typically divides the document into sections including background information, legal arguments, and a conclusion. These headings guide the reader through the document, ensuring logical flow and coherence. Writing with your audience in mind is equally important; tailoring your content for judges, colleagues, or clients helps maintain an appropriate tone and level of detail that resonates with each group's expectations.

Conduct thorough legal research to build a solid foundation.
Structure using standard headings: Background Information, Legal Argument, Conclusion.
Consider your audience’s perspective and expectations during drafting.

Common challenges and solutions

Navigating complex legal language can pose a significant challenge for those drafting memorandums and orders. Simplifying jargon and legalese is critical for ensuring that the document is understandable by all parties involved. Utilizing clear, concise language will help demystify legal terms and promote comprehension among non-legal professionals.

Additionally, avoiding common mistakes during the drafting and filing process is crucial. Having a checklist for common errors — such as overlooking required signatures or failing to cite relevant laws — can promptly address issues before submission. Finally, maintaining compliance with legal standards requires vigilance; reviewing current legal practices and norms periodically can safeguard the integrity of your memorandum and order.

Simplify legal jargon for better understanding.
Create a checklist for common drafting and filing mistakes.
Stay updated on legal standards to maintain compliance.
